Runbook: Timezone Handling — Report Exports

Reviewer notes. All Quillport report exports must serialize timestamps in UTC; the renderer applies viewer timezone client-side. Do not accept patches that format dates server-side using the worker's locale — that caused the Marrowgate incident. Check that the export job reads tz config from the tenant record, not the request header. Confirm golden-file tests cover DST boundaries for at least two offsets. Verify the fix against the trace token listed directly below.

pipeline stamp: htk31_f769b577b3028a4e9958e5bb8d1259a

Subject: Welcome to on-call — FlagWeave rollout basics

Hi Priya,

Welcome to the rotation. FlagWeave is our feature-flag rollout framework, and most pages you'll see this week trace back to misconfigured ramp schedules. Before acknowledging any FlagWeave alert, check the active rollout stage, confirm the kill-switch state, and note whether the flag targets the Tellhurst cluster. Never bump a ramp percentage during an active incident. The full escalation checklist and stage definitions live on the internal page here.

wiki page, tahaf-tajog: https://jira.ordindyn.corp/pipeline

# Break-Glass: Catalog Cache Invalidation

Scope: the Pinrow product catalog at Veldstone Retail. If stale prices persist after a purge and the Hollowmere invalidation queue is wedged, use break-glass to flush the edge tier directly. Contractors: get verbal sign-off from the catalog lead first. Steps: open the Hollowmere admin shell, select emergency-flush, confirm the tenant, and run it once — repeated flushes thrash the origin. Access is logged and expires after 20 minutes. Unseal the admin shell with the passphrase below.

recovery phrase for kahop-tajog: istix-casvan

Key ceremony checklist — item 7 (cron migration). Before sealing the shard, confirm all Gristmill cron jobs now run under the Weftline workflow engine and the legacy crontab is disabled, not deleted. Contractor note: do not touch the two finance jobs flagged amber; Ilsa owns those. Witness signs the ledger after verification. Unseal the ceremony envelope using the passphrase printed below.

recovery phrase for bawep-kawef: oliath-casdor